The sustained physiological capacity for high levels of physical strength, metabolic efficiency, and mental fortitude that transcends the typical limitations imposed by chronological aging. This state represents a clinically optimized phenotype where endocrine, musculoskeletal, and cardiovascular systems function at a robust, youthful equilibrium. It signifies the successful mitigation of sarcopenia, frailty, and metabolic dysfunction well into later life stages.
Origin
This phrase is derived from the confluence of modern sports medicine, endocrinology, and the burgeoning field of human longevity science. It is an aspirational term used to describe the clinical outcome of successful hormonal and metabolic interventions. The concept moves the focus from merely extending lifespan to enhancing the quality and functional capacity of those extended years.
Mechanism
The underlying mechanism involves the meticulous regulation of anabolic hormones, such as testosterone, growth hormone, and DHEA, which are essential for maintaining lean body mass and bone mineral density. It also relies on optimizing insulin sensitivity and mitochondrial health to ensure efficient energy production and substrate utilization at a cellular level. Maintaining a low systemic inflammatory burden is a critical component, allowing for consistent tissue repair and regeneration.
